Aberdour Castle

8.2/10 (15 reviews)
One of Scotland's oldest stone castles, Aberdour showcases medieval and Renaissance architecture dating to the 12th century. Wander through terraced gardens and marvel at the rare 17th-century painted ceiling.

Inchcolm Abbey

10.0/10 (1 review)
This 12th-century monastery stands as Scotland's most intact medieval abbey on a serene island. Explore ancient cloisters while enjoying panoramic views of Edinburgh's skyline across the Firth of Forth.

Burntisland Golf House Club

10.0/10 (1 review)
Established in 1797, Burntisland Golf House Club is among the world's oldest golf clubs, featuring a course that blends parkland and links styles with spectacular Firth of Forth views.

Best time to go to Burntisland

The best time to visit Burntisland is dependent on what kind of holiday you are seeking. July is its hottest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are moderately high and weather is mostly cloudy with light rain. January is its coolest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are moderately low and weather is mostly cloudy with light rain.

calendar iconCalendar Monthtemperature iconTemperaturerain iconPrecipitationmostly cloudy iconCloudinessoccupation rate iconOccupancyprice iconPricing
January38.7°F (3.7°C)Light RainMostly CloudyModerately LowSlightly Low
February39.6°F (4.2°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ly Low
March41.9°F (5.5°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ly Low
April45.1°F (7.3°C)No R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
May50.0°F (10.0°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
June55.2°F (12.9°C)Light RainMostly CloudyModerately HighSlightly High
July58.3°F (14.6°C)Light RainMostly CloudyModerately HighSlightly High
August57.6°F (14.2°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ly High
September54.5°F (12.5°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
October49.6°F (9.8°C)Light RainMostly CloudyModerately LowAverage
November43.9°F (6.6°C)Light RainMostly CloudyModerately LowAverage
December39.7°F (4.3°C)Light RainMostly CloudyModerately HighAverage

How can I get around Burntisland?
If you'd like to explore more of the area, take a train from Burntisland Station, Kinghorn Station or Aberdour Station. If you want to venture out around the area, you may want a rental car in Burntisland for your journey.
What's the seasonal weather like in Burntisland?
The hottest months are usually July and August, with an average temperature of 14°C, while the coldest months are January and February, with an average of 4°C. Average annual precipitation for Burntisland is 835 mm.
